The Hottest Cards: Mega Manectric-ex, Clefable-ex, and More

So, what are we actually going to find in these boosters? The core of the expansion is obviously the new mechanics around Mega Evolution, but with that "ascendant chaos" twist. I managed to sneak a peek at some visuals floating around in the backrooms of a few specialty shops (no, I won't tell you how), and I can guarantee that some of these cards are going to be absolute must-haves. Here’s a look at the most anticipated ones:

  • Mega Manectric-ex: The crown jewel. Explosive artwork, HP totals that defy belief, and an attack that looks like it can one-shot any opposing Pokémon-ex. This is the card that will likely define the meta.
  • Clefable-ex (Ascendant Chaos version): Already hinted at in the early rumours around Perfect Order, it's resurfacing here with an ability that could revolutionise the early game. An urgent addition for any collection.
  • Mewtwo & Mew-GX (Alt-art reprint): For the nostalgics and the speculators, a secret rare variant of this legendary duo is rumoured to be appearing. The kind of card that skyrockets the value of a booster pack all on its own.

Of course, these are just sneak peeks. The full set list promises over a hundred cards, featuring star Pokémon, but also essential Supporters and Item cards for building the ultimate deck. How to Play Mega Evolution: Ascendant Chaos? Breaking Down the New Mechanic

The real spice of this expansion is that "chaotic ascension." In practical terms, how to use Mega Evolution: Ascendant Chaos in an actual game? The core idea builds on classic Mega Evolution (you need the item and the base Pokémon), but with a twist: upon evolving, the Pokémon triggers a "chaos" effect that can either boost your side or... hinder your opponent in unpredictable ways. We're talking dice rolls, extra draws, or placing damage counters randomly. In short, it's controlled chaos that will reward adaptable players. The more strategic-minded will need to include cards like Chaos Seeker or Control Tower to channel this power. It's simple: deckbuilding has never been more crucial.
